What is a strategy manager?

A strategy manager oversees an organization’s progress toward departmental goals. As a strategy manager, you work closely with senior-level administrators to determine how best to reach the company’s objectives. Job duties vary, depending on the industry and the type of company, but they typically include collecting and analyzing data, researching trends, and mapping out plans to reach your goals. You may also train employees on how to implement your strategies more efficiently. Strategy managers typically work within a specific department of a large company, such as marketing, sales, or distribution. For example, a sales strategy manager serves as a liaison between upper management and the sales team, networks with potential clients and other business contacts, and trains the sales department on how to increase sales.

What is the difference between Strategy Manager vs Business Analyst?

AspectStrategy ManagerBusiness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ree; often MBA; strategic planning certificationsBachelor's degree; certifications like CBAP or PMI-PBA beneficial
Work EnvironmentCorporate strategy teams, consulting firms, senior managementProject teams, operational departments, consulting projects
Employer & Industry UsageLarge corporations, consulting firms, finance, techVarious industries including finance, healthcare, tech, and manufacturing

The main difference between a Strategy Manager and a Business Analyst lies in their focus and scope. Strategy Managers develop long-term plans and oversee strategic initiatives, while Business Analysts analyze business processes and support project implementation. Strategy Managers typically operate at a higher strategic level, whereas Business Analysts focus on specific projects and operational improvements.

What does a strategy manager do?

A strategy manager develops and implements long-term plans to help an organization achieve its goals. They analyze market trends, assess internal capabilities, and collaborate with leadership to identify growth opportunities, often using tools like SWOT analysis and strategic frameworks. Strong analytical, communication, and leadership skills are essential for success in this role.
